()The LCS-30-N4 is a type of liquid level controller designed to monitor and control the liquid level in a vessel or container. It is typically used in various industrial applications such as the tank-filling and chemical processing industries. The controller works by using a special electronic system to constantly monitor the fluid level in the vessel while it is being filled or emptied.
The controller is an effective tool for controlling the level of liquid in a vessel or containers. It features two main components: the sensing system and the driving system. The sensing system consists of a pair of probes which measure the liquid level in the vessel. These probes are mounted directly onto the vessel and can be configured to measure of any liquid, including water, oil, and other fluids.
The sensing probes are connected to a remote control panel. This panel is responsible for receiving signals from the probes and for responding to changes in the liquid level.
